Description
Hi! My name is Nano and I’m the host of a shared house in El Palomar (western area of Buenos Aires), located about 1 to 1.5 hours from downtown by public transport.
This is a shared living project based on cultural exchange: volunteers help with daily tasks in exchange for accommodation and a community experience.
We aim to create a calm space where people from different countries live together, share and collaborate with respect.
I live in the house and actively take part in daily life. We value open communication, good coexistence and a more local, authentic experience of Buenos Aires.

Help
This is a community project in its early stages. Volunteers mainly help with the daily life of a shared house and the gradual development of the space.
Tasks may include:
Cleaning and maintenance of common areas
Organizing and keeping spaces tidy
Small improvements around the house (light painting, decoration, basic gardening)
Language exchange
Proposing or facilitating cultural or artistic activities
Creating content for social media (Instagram)
Tasks are flexible and can be adapted to each volunteer’s skills, interests and energy.

Accommodation
Accommodation is in a shared house, in a shared room with a single bed. The house is simple, lived-in and in progress, but it is kept clean and functional. Bathroom, kitchen and common areas are shared.
We provide a bed and basic bedding. The house has hot water, electricity, internet and comfortable spaces to relax and socialize. Food is not included, but you are free to use the kitchen and organize meals together with others.
This is a shared living experience, not a hotel.
The accommodation is best suited for people who are open to community life, respectful of shared spaces and comfortable living with others.

During their time off, helpers here have many opportunities to explore both local life and the wider city, while still enjoying a calm place to return to.
The house is located in the western area of Buenos Aires, in a residential neighborhood that offers a more authentic and non-touristic experience. Nearby areas such as El Palomar and Ramos Mejía have cafés, bars, bakeries, local markets, gyms and small shops, making daily life easy and enjoyable.
